键盘连击智能拦截:机械键盘精准控制解决方案
1. 诊断连击故障:如何判断你的键盘是否"生病"了?
当你在文档中输入"hello"却出现"hheelloo",或是游戏中技能不受控制地连续释放时,你的键盘可能正遭受连击故障的困扰。这种被称为"键盘抖动"的现象,并非键盘硬件彻底损坏的信号,而是机械轴体氧化或触点磨损导致的接触不良。
连击故障的三大典型特征:
- 重复性:特定按键(如空格键、回车键)持续出现重复输入
- 间歇性:故障在快速打字时加重,慢速输入时减轻
- 特异性:问题通常集中在1-2个常用按键,而非全键盘
键盘响应优化 - 软件实时监控界面显示按键触发时间、按键名称和连击延迟,帮助识别问题按键
2. 透视拦截原理:键盘如何学会"思考"?
表层现象:按键为何会"失控"?
机械键盘的每个按键就像一个微型开关,当你按下按键时,金属触点接触形成通路。随着使用时间增加,触点氧化会导致接触不稳定,形成"虚假触发"——一次物理按压被识别为多次电信号。
中层机制:去抖动算法(Debounce)如何工作?
KeyboardChatterBlocker采用的去抖动算法类似电梯等待机制:当电梯门开始关闭时(首次按键信号),如果在设定时间内(阈值)检测到再次触发(抖动信号),系统会忽略后续信号,直到稳定期结束。
底层算法:时间窗口过滤技术
软件通过滑动时间窗口记录每个按键的触发时刻,当两个相同按键的触发间隔小于设定阈值时,第二个信号会被判定为连击并拦截。这一过程发生在系统处理按键事件之前,因此对用户操作的响应延迟几乎不可察觉。
3. 分级解决方案:三步梯度优化法
基础防护:5分钟快速部署
- 启动KeyboardChatterBlocker并勾选"Enable"启用拦截功能
- 设置全局阈值为50ms(普通用户推荐值)
- 勾选"Start With Windows"和"Start In Tray"确保持续保护
精准调控:问题按键靶向治疗
- 切换到"Chatter Log"标签页观察10分钟打字记录
- 记录连击延迟低于50ms的高频按键(如示例中的H键)
- 在"Configure Keys"标签页为问题按键设置独立阈值(H键设120ms)
键盘响应优化 - 个性化按键配置面板支持为不同按键设置独立的连击阈值,实现精准拦截
场景定制:环境自适应方案
创建三个配置文件模板:
- 办公模式:全局阈值80ms,空格键50ms,字母键100ms
- 游戏模式:全局阈值60ms,技能键70ms,方向键50ms
- 编程模式:全局阈值100ms,符号键120ms,退格键80ms
4. 场景适配指南:让键盘学会"察言观色"
连击风险评估矩阵
| 使用场景 | 风险等级 | 推荐阈值范围 | 关键优化按键 |
|---|---|---|---|
| 文档编辑 | 中高 | 80-100ms | 空格键、退格键、常用字母 |
| 游戏竞技 | 高 | 60-80ms | 技能键、方向键、Ctrl/Shift |
| 代码编写 | 中 | 90-120ms | 括号、分号、等号 |
| 数据录入 | 低 | 50-70ms | 数字键、Enter键 |
反常识解决方案:动态阈值技术
游戏玩家可尝试"自适应阈值"策略:在检测到连续技能释放时(如1秒内3次以上相同按键),自动将阈值降低20%以提高响应速度,平时保持较高阈值防止误触。
阈值设置的心理物理学依据
研究表明,人类手指的最小稳定按压间隔约为80-120ms,低于此范围的连续触发几乎都是无意识动作。因此,将常用按键阈值设置为80ms,既能有效拦截机械抖动,又不会影响正常打字节奏。
5. 故障排除决策树
-
问题:所有按键都出现连击
- 检查全局阈值是否设置过高(>150ms)
- 确认软件是否处于"Enable"状态
- 尝试重启电脑并重开软件
-
问题:特定按键拦截过度
- 降低该按键的独立阈值20-30ms
- 检查是否误将常用键添加到拦截列表
- 清理键盘物理按键是否存在卡键
-
问题:拦截效果不稳定
- 检查是否有其他键盘管理软件冲突
- 尝试以管理员模式运行程序
- 更新软件到最新版本
6. 压力测试工具推荐
- KeyboardTestUtility:可生成按键压力测试报告,识别问题按键
- PassMark KeyboardTest:提供按键响应时间可视化分析
- KeyBoardTester:支持自定义压力测试方案,模拟不同使用场景
通过这套系统化方案,你无需更换硬件即可让老旧键盘恢复90%以上的精准度。KeyboardChatterBlocker作为一款轻量级工具(内存占用<10MB),在后台默默工作,让你重新获得对键盘的绝对控制——无论是撰写文档、编写代码还是激烈游戏,都能享受如新机般的输入体验。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ust099-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00